Bernie Sanders showed up at Walmart's annual shareholder meeting to call for a $15-an-hour minimum wage at the retail giant

Sen. Bernie Sanders appeared at Walmart Inc.’s annual shareholder meeting on Wednesday to push the retail giant to raise its minimum wage, the latest sign that the retail giant can’t fully shake a reputation—in some quarters— as a bad place to work.

“Walmart pays many of its employees starvation wages,” said the Democratic presidential candidate, addressing company executives and a board that includes three members of Walmart founder Sam Walton’s family, which he noted is one of the country’s wealthiest. “Surely with all...
